Harumama Spinoff, Teriyaki & Bao To Open In Carlsbad

Local restaurateurs, Jenny and James Pyo, who own and operate Love Boat Sushi, Pokewan, Blue Ocean and Harumama, are bringing a new concept to Carlsbad. Officially opening on November 5, 2020, Teriyaki & Bao is an Asian-fusion, DIY restaurant located at 711 Grand Avenue in Carlsbad.

Be your own chef!

At Teriyaki & Bao, every diner is their own chef. At this Harumama spinoff, guests can enjoy the excitement and entertainment of cooking up their own sizzling meal in a personal-size cast-iron skillet heated to 500ºF. Diners can customize their dish with several high-quality meats, vegetables, rice, noodles and curries that can be “cooked your way” on the hot skillet. Since the skillet remains hot for more than 20 minutes, diners can enjoy the warm meal until the very last bite!

Other unique menu items draw inspiration from internet-famous Asian food trends, like

  • Tornado Fried Rice which is classic fried rice with a tornado omelette and tomato sauce,
  • Creamy Matcha Udon with curry, green tea powder, potato, bell pepper, edamame, carrot and onion.
  • Almond Cauliflower Bites served Korean style with gochujang sauce.

Harumama’s Instagram-worthy character buns are here!

Also on the menu are Harumama’s Instagram-favorite steamed character buns, now with new character designs and fillings as well as never-before-seen character Bao buns which are unique to this location. Beverages include beer, wine, soju and sake, with happy hour and lunch combos coming soon.
